FLIR thermal imaging cameras revolutionize the way we view our world. Unlike traditional sensors that capture visible light, FLIR cameras detect infrared radiation emitted by objects. This allows us to pinpoint temperature differences, even in obscured environments. Whether you're a technician in fields like construction or simply curious about exploring the unseen world, FLIR thermal imaging offers a powerful perspective.

  • Applications of FLIR cameras are vast and varied:
  • Locating heat loss in buildings
  • Evaluating electrical equipment for overheating
  • Pinpointing wildlife in their natural habitats
  • Supporting search and rescue operations

With FLIR, you can see the world through a lens of heat, revealing hidden patterns and knowledge that were previously invisible.

Exploring the Invisible: FLIR Thermal Imaging

The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. Infrared cameras leverage this power, revealing temperature variations invisible to the human eye. This remarkable technology has revolutionized numerous fields, from building diagnostics to scientific research.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ify anomalies, monitor performance, and enhance safety in ways never before possible.
